VICTORVILLE >> Authorities Friday arrested a delivery driver in connection with an indecent exposure incident Tuesday and believed he might have exposed himself to others. Saeid Nikpour, 56, of Diamond Bar was arrested 9 a.m. Friday in Covina on suspicion of indecent exposure, a San Bernardino County sheriff's news release states.

A Corona man who "flashed" a woman stopped next to him at a Jurupa Valley intersection last fall was sentenced Thursday, April 13, to three years' probation. Mario Guadalupe Mendiola, 45, pleaded guilty in February to felony indecent exposure.

Nearly $1 billion in side deals for California gas tax approved

$
0
0

The side deals surfaced in the lead-up to the April 6 gas-tax vote - which passed narrowly, without a vote to spare - as amendments on a separate bill, Senate Bill 132 . They included nearly $1 billion in transportation projects benefiting the swing districts represented by Assemblyman Adam Gray, D-Merced; Sen. Anthony Cannella, R-Ceres; Assemblywoman Sabrina Cervantes, D-Corona and Sen. Richard Roth, D-Riverside.
